首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用 DAX 快速构建一个日期

方法二: Power Query 完成。 方法三:在数据模型中用 DAX 完成。...更精确地说,对于某个日期,如:yyyy-MM-dd,记作 D1,其日期区间跨度为 1 日。而常用的日期区间的跨度都会大于 1 日。...A - 一列,日期时间 B - 一列,日期 C - 三列,年月日 D - 四列,年季月日 通过对上述内容的理解,不难看出 B 才是正确答案。... DAX ,可以构建表,准确讲,是一个单列的表,如下: DAX 函数 CalendarAuto 将轮询目前在数据模型的每一个表日期类型列以便创建一个日期序列,该序列包括可以涵盖数模模型所有日期范围...总结 关于日期表的讲解,的确看到了很多,但本文给出的视角以及如何从这个视角进行实际操作,相信能让很多刚刚入门不久的伙伴有快速而深入的理解。 以上 DAX 公式,你也可以直接复制粘贴使用,无需修改。

2.5K20
您找到你想要的搜索结果了吗?
是的
没有找到

MySQL周期表管理太繁琐,通过Python自定义工具方法优雅解决

从功能设计上,有下面的一些小的功能需要完善和补充: 生成周期表的创建语句 检测失效的周期表 转置失效的周期表 删除失效的周期表 周期表阈值检测 数据是否存在的检测 周期表连续性检查 周期表可访问预检查...周期表自动创建 对于里面的一个功能,如何检测周期表是否连续,出发点是很好的,但是实现的时候发现比想象的要复杂一些。...N个小时后的时间 N个小时前的时间 今天前的第N天 今天后的第N天 今天以前的N天列表 今天以后的N天列表 指定时间范围的时间列表 判断日期是否日期范围之内 两个日期列表相同的日期 两个日期列表差异的日期...)) return t # 得到几个小时后的时间 def afterHours2Date(hours, date_format='%Y-%m-%d %H:%M:%S'): hours =...time1.strftime("%Y-%m-%d") # 判断日期是否指定的列表 def date_in_range(date_str,start_date,end_date): return

57910

4.3 C++ Boost 日期时间操作库

本节,我们首先介绍了boost库中常见的日期格式化输出控制字符,例如%Y、%m等,然后通过举例和代码示范的方式,演示了如何日期对象中使用这些格式化字符,并将日期转为对应的字符串格式。...实际开发,经常需要对时间区间进行判断,以便更好地满足业务需求。本节示例介绍了如何使用boost库中提供的日期区间函数进行日期范围判断,以及如何通过代码示例演示如何使用这些函数。...具体而言,我们介绍了如何判断一个日期是否指定的日期区间范围内,如何判断两个日期区间是否重叠,以及如何获得两个日期区间的交集等等。...实际开发,经常需要对一段时间内的日期进行遍历,以便进行数据处理等操作。本节介绍了如何使用boost库日期迭代器,以及如何通过代码示例演示如何使用这些迭代器。...本节,我们首先介绍了如何获取当前时间,包括获取时间点类型、日期类型、以及时间类型等等;然后,我们介绍了如何计算时间差值,包括使用时间持续类型、时钟类型等等;最后,我们介绍了如何比较时间大小,包括比较时间点和日期等等

32550

4.3 C++ Boost 日期时间操作库

本节,我们首先介绍了boost库中常见的日期格式化输出控制字符,例如%Y、%m等,然后通过举例和代码示范的方式,演示了如何日期对象中使用这些格式化字符,并将日期转为对应的字符串格式。...实际开发,经常需要对时间区间进行判断,以便更好地满足业务需求。本节示例介绍了如何使用boost库中提供的日期区间函数进行日期范围判断,以及如何通过代码示例演示如何使用这些函数。...具体而言,我们介绍了如何判断一个日期是否指定的日期区间范围内,如何判断两个日期区间是否重叠,以及如何获得两个日期区间的交集等等。...实际开发,经常需要对一段时间内的日期进行遍历,以便进行数据处理等操作。本节介绍了如何使用boost库日期迭代器,以及如何通过代码示例演示如何使用这些迭代器。...本节,我们首先介绍了如何获取当前时间,包括获取时间点类型、日期类型、以及时间类型等等;然后,我们介绍了如何计算时间差值,包括使用时间持续类型、时钟类型等等;最后,我们介绍了如何比较时间大小,包括比较时间点和日期等等

36640

Java8关于日期时间API的20个使用示例

一、前言 随着lambda表达式、streams以及一系列小优化,Java8推出了全新的日期时间API,一下的指南中我们将通过一些简单的示例来学习如何使用新API。...示例 4、Java8判断两个日期是否相等 现实生活中有一类时间处理就是判断两个日期是否相等。你常常会检查今天是不是个特殊的日子,比如生日、纪念日或非交易日。...这时就需要把指定的日期某个特定日期做比较,例如判断这一天是否是假期。...示例 5、Java8检查像生日这种周期性事件 Java另一个日期时间的处理就是检查类似每月账单、结婚纪念日、EMI日或保险缴费日这些周期性事件。...我们学会了如何创建并操作日期实例,学习了纯日期以及包含时间信息和时差信息的日期、学会了怎样计算两个日期的间隔,这些计算当天与某个特定日期间隔的例子中都有所展示。

2.7K20

Java 8新的时间日期库的20个使用示例

除了lambda表达式,stream以及几个小的改进之外,Java 8还引入了一套全新的时间日期API,本篇教程我们将通过几个简单的任务示例来学习如何使用Java 8的这套API。...示例4 Java 8如何检查两个日期是否相等 如果说起现实实际的处理时间日期的任务,有一个常见的就是要检查两个日期是否相等。...示例5 Java 8如何检查重复事件,比如说生日 Java还有一个与时间日期相关的实际任务就是检查重复事件,比如说每月的帐单日,结婚纪念日,每月还款日或者是每年交保险费的日子。...它和新的时间日期的其它类一样也都是不可变且线程安全的,并且它还是一个值类(value class)。我们通过一个例子来看下如何使用MonthDay来检查某个重复的日期: ?...示例11 Java如何判断某个日期另一个日期的前面还是后面 这也是实际项目中常见的一个任务。你怎么判断某个日期另一个日期的前面还是后面,或者正好相等呢?

2.1K20

Java8新日期处理API

3、java8如何获取某个特定的日期 通过另一个方法,可以创建出任意一个日期,它接受年月日的参数,然后返回一个等价的LocalDate实例。...4、java8检查两个日期是否相等 LocalDate重写了equals方法来进行日期的比较,如下所示: ?...5、java8如何检查重复事件,比如生日 java还有一个与时间日期相关的任务就是检查重复事件,比如每月的账单日 如何在java判断是否某个节日或者重复事件,使用MonthDay类。...11、java如何判断某个日期另一个日期的前面还是后面  如何判断某个日期另一个日期的前面还是后面或者相等,java8,LocalDate类中使用isBefore()、isAfter()、...14、如何在java8检查闰年 LocalDate类由一个isLeapYear()方法来返回当前LocalDate对应的那年是否是闰年 ?

4.1K100

java关于时间的用法示例

参考链接: Java的类型转换和示例 除了lambda表达式,stream以及几个小的改进之外,Java 8还引入了一套全新的时间日期API,本篇教程我们将通过几个简单的任务示例来学习如何使用Java...示例3 Java 8如何获取某个特定的日期   第一个例子,我们看到通过静态方法now()来生成当天日期是非常简单的,不过通过另一个十分有用的工厂方法LocalDate.of(),则可以创建出任意一个日期...示例4 Java 8如何检查两个日期是否相等   如果说起现实实际的处理时间日期的任务,有一个常见的就是要检查两个日期是否相等。...示例5 Java 8如何检查重复事件,比如说生日   Java还有一个与时间日期相关的实际任务就是检查重复事件,比如说每月的帐单日,结婚纪念日,每月还款日或者是每年交保险费的日子。...示例11 Java如何判断某个日期另一个日期的前面还是后面   这也是实际项目中常见的一个任务。你怎么判断某个日期另一个日期的前面还是后面,或者正好相等呢?

1.3K20

python常用的备份脚本

脚本介绍: 1)备份源目录的文件 2)目标文件以tar 和bzip2的方式压缩之后放在当前日期文件夹下 4)备份文件以时间注释和执行脚本的用户命名 3)主要用到了时间模块,系统模块,和getpass模块...m%d')  now = time.strftime('%H%M%S')  comment = raw_input('please input comment --> ')   if len(comment...m%d')  #定义今日的日期  now = time.strftime('%H%M%S')  #定义现在的时间   comment = raw_input('please input text -->... ')   #定义注释为输入的字符串  if len(comment) == 0:  #检查输入的注释是否为空       target = today + now + '_' + user + '_'...+ user + '_' + 'tar.bz2'   #如果非空,则使用日期时间注释用户为文件名  if not os.path.exists(today):   #检查备份目录下的时间目录是否不存在

97510

整理总结 python 时间日期类数据处理与类型转换(含 pandas)

如何检查自己是否安装了某个库,如何安装它,又如何查看和更新版本,对新手来说是一个比较大的话题,也是基础技能,值得另外整理一篇笔记,就不在这里占篇幅了。...# 把 struct_time 转换为指定格式的字符串 # '2019-09-28 12:12:01 Saturday' good = time.strftime("%Y-%m-%d %H:%M:%S...%m-%d %H:%M:%S %A") 我的笔记,仅整理总结自己常用的方法,至于我自己从未用到或很少用到的方法,并不罗列其中。...某个数据是什么类型,如何查看,某个方法对数据类型有什么要求,如何转换数据类型,这些都是实战特别关心的。...('%Y-%m-%d %H:%M:%S',y) 把上一步得到的 struct_time 转换为 字符串 lambda x:z 匿名函数,输入一个值x,得到字符串z df['c_col'].apply()

2.2K10
领券